What's your business, and who are your customers?

We are a keto bakery, tailoring our treats to individuals living a low carb, sugar-free lifestyle - including people with diabetes! Everyone deserves to be able to enjoy a sweet treat, and we aim to provide that without that dreaded word “cheating.”

Tell us about yourself

I’ve always loved baking and eating sweets. When I started a keto diet, I dearly missed eating something sweet after meals. I really, really wanted a cookie. Motivated to make a cookie that fulfilled my cravings but kept the carb count down, I started to create traditional desserts with a modern dietary twist. After years of recipe development and many failed attempts, dishes started coming together. I’m starting to see more orders coming in with notes from customers (especially diabetics) who were not able to enjoy a cupcake without their health suffering the consequences. Being able to help families come together over birthdays, so no one is excluded warms my heart. Helping people of all ages enjoy a sweet treat, guilt-free and tasteful full drives my passion to continue creating new, healthy treats.

What's one of the hardest things that come with being a business owner?

Wearing multiple hats! Not only am I the baker, but I’m also the customer service specialist, sales rep, accountant, marketer, quality control, etc. As I continue to grow the business, I look forward to hiring great people to help!

What are the top tips you'd give to anyone looking to start, run and grow a business today?

Build yourself a strong foundation, both internally and around you. Do your research (read or listen to books) and have people in your corner to hold you accountable. I am fortunate; my coach is always ready to walk me through the good and bad times, and I am surrounded by a network of people supporting and rooting for me. When I struggle, I go to them for a reality check. Be the best version of yourself when interacting with customers. As corny as it sounds, treat them how you’d like to be treated, and go above and beyond when possible! Also, don’t undervalue yourself! Don’t go out giving all the discounts, don’t do things for free. Your time is valuable, as are your resources and creativity. You are worth what your charge for your products or services. Lastly, take time for yourself! We are only human, after all. Setting aside this time has been so important for me. It keeps me loving my business and what I do.
